ChatGPT photo editing prompts: 6 commands you should know for better image generation in 2025

MC Tech Desk | July 19, 2025 / 17:35 IST
1/6
Remove the unwanted object
Remove the unwanted object
If you want to clear something from your photo — a garbage can in the background or a person you’d like gone — you can simply prompt, “Remove the garbage can from the photo.” The tool will erase it and blend the surroundings smoothly.
2/6
Change colour of an object
Change colour of an object
Your photo might look better with a different colour. If you want a red car to be blue, you can prompt, “Change the colour of the car to blue.” The tool will adjust it while keeping the texture and lighting consistent.
3/6
Add a small element
Add a small element
Sometimes adding something tiny — a flower in a vase or a hat on someone — can enhance a photo’s story. Try prompting, “Add a small flower on the table.”
4/6
Expand background
Expand background
Want more space around your photo’s borders? Say, “Expand the background on all sides.” The tool will generate additional details to match the scene.
5/6
Brighten or darken photo
Brighten or darken photo
If your photo is a bit dim or washed out, you can prompt, “Brighten the photo” or “Make the photo darker” to adjust the lighting quickly.
6/6
Apply artistic style like Ghibli effect, GTA VI
Apply artistic style
If you want your photo to resemble a painting or a comic, you can say, “Transform photo into a watercolour painting” or “Make it look like a comic book scene.”
